Report: Timing Chain Noise May Lead to Timing Chain Failure on Higher Mileage Vehicles

Nissan Pulsar NX Problem
1 Report

Model Year Affected: 1990

Engine Affected: 1.6L 4 Cylinder

Verified

Excessive timing chain noise, a rattling or ticking, on higher mileage cars may lead to timing chain failure, which can cause engine damage. There are upgraded chain tension guides with a steel backing to improve durability and a modified repair procedure no longer requires the removal of the cylinder head to replace the timing chain. Maintaining proper engine oil level and frequent oil changes are important to ensure the long-term durability of this engine.
